write the standard form of the equation of the parabola that has the indicated vertex and whose graph passes through the given p

oint. show all work. vertex(4,7)Point(3,6)

Vertex form of parabola is

y = a(x - b)^2 + c   where a is a constant and  the vertex is at the point (b,c)

so here we have

y = a(x - 4)^2 + 7

To find value of a we plug in the point  (3,6)

6 = a(3 - 4)^2 + 7
6 = a + 7
a =  6-7 = -1

so equation is y = -(x - 4)^2 + 7

Covert to standard form:-
y = -(x^2 - 8x + 16) + 7
y = -x^2 + 8x - 9
